Mutu plans charitable solution
Fiorentina forward Adrian Mutu has offered to make a huge donation to charity if his former employer's Chelsea are prepared to waive his 17million euro fine. Mutu was handed the huge fine by Fifa for breaching his contract at Stamford Bridge after he tested positive for cocaine in 2004.
Mutu took his case to the Court of Arbitration for Sport (CAS) but they upheld Fifa's ruling.
